WebJan 1, 2024 · That aside, regardless of the weather, mature bucks generally prefer to bed on the leeward (downwind) side of a ridge anyway. As noted by big-buck expert Dan Infalt, deer usually bed along the top third of a ridge in hill country, where the prevailing wind brings air over the top of the ridge to them, and thermals rise from the valley below. Hill country bedding Chapter … WebSep 22, 2010 · Saddles permit this behavior by reducing the amount of time the buck remains on the skyline. Saddles accomplish the buck’s goal of staying out of sight by lowering the ridgeline. When a buck is crossing from one slope to another, a saddle makes the mission easier. Saddles funnel all manner of game.

The leeward side of a ridge or bluff leeward meaning the downwind side is a great place for finding buck beds in big woods. The buck will use the bluff to watch the area in front while only bedding in a spot where the wind is blowing from behind. Then he has the front covered with his eyes and ...
